Rooks County is a county located in the U.S. state of Kansas. Its county seat is Stockton,[2] and its largest city is Plainville. As of the 2020 census, the county population was 4,919.[1] The county was named for John Rooks, a private in Company I of the 11th Kansas Cavalry Regiment, who died at the Battle of Prairie Grove during the American Civil War.[3]
